; eau douce; saumâtre démersal. Subtropical
Oceania: southern Queensland to South Australia, apparently not in Tasmania.
Taille / Poids / Âge
Maturity: Lm ?  range ? - ? cm
Max length : 6.0 cm TL mâle / non sexé; (Ref. 9002)
Facultative air-breathing (Ref. 126274); Found in mangroves, entering the lower reaches of freshwater streams (Ref. 9002).
